What are the cultivation methods and precautions for Daphne koreana potted plants?

Introduction of Daphne

Daphne belongs to the Thymelaeaceae family and is a relatively traditional flower. Its plant is relatively short, so it is also called Penglai flower.

When propagating, cutting propagation and layering propagation are generally used. The most commonly used method is cutting, which requires the use of relatively sturdy branches, so that the survival rate will be higher.

Cultivation method of Daphne koreana in pot

When growing, Daphne koreana is usually planted in a semi-shaded environment. It requires appropriate sunlight and should avoid exposure to the scorching sun.

Daphne koreana has poor cold resistance and is not tolerant to waterlogging. It needs to be watered in moderation, and loose, fertile, and well-drained soil should be used when planting.

Watering

When caring for the Daphne koreana potted plant, it needs to be watered appropriately. It is not very resistant to waterlogging, so wait until the soil is relatively dry before watering to avoid water accumulation.

Fertilization

The Daphne koreana potted plant needs to be fertilized in moderation at ordinary times, usually once every 1-2 months. It is necessary to use well-rotted fertilizer. Remember not to use concentrated fertilizer, otherwise it will damage the root system.

prune

Daphne koreana grows very fast during the seedling stage, so in order to avoid excessive growth, the tender shoots on top need to be pruned off in time, which can promote the growth of branches.

Precautions for cultivating Daphne koreana in pots

When caring for the Daphne koreana potted plant, you need to pay attention to the fact that it needs to be repotted after two years of cultivation, which is usually done before budding in spring. This will allow it to have sufficient nutrients for growth. It usually needs to be placed in a well-ventilated place for maintenance.
